How much does roof cleaning cost in Florida?


If you’re a Florida homeowner, you’ve probably noticed how quickly roofs can collect dirt, algae, and mildew thanks to the humid climate. That’s where professional roof cleaning comes in—and costs can vary depending on the size and type of your roof. On average, roof cleaning in Florida ranges from $250 to $800.

Smaller single-story homes often fall on the lower end, while larger or multi-story properties may run higher. The cleaning method also plays a role—soft washing (recommended for shingle and tile roofs) is generally safer but can cost more than basic pressure washing. Extra factors like heavy buildup, steep pitches, or delicate materials may also increase the price.

While it may feel like a big investment, routine roof cleaning not only improves curb appeal but also extends the lifespan of your roof—saving you money in the long run. Always ask for a clear, written estimate before scheduling.
